Special Journals
Customized accounting journals used for recording specific types of transactions that occur frequently.
General Journal
A primary accounting record where all types of financial transactions are initially recorded in chronological order before being posted to specific accounts in the general ledger.
Cash Receipts Journal
A specific financial journal used in accounting to record all cash inflows to a business.
Sales Journal
A specialized accounting ledger that records all sales transactions of a business, typically for goods or services on credit.
